This NACE International standard test method provides descriptions of the measurement techniques and cautionary measures most commonly used on underground tanks to determine whether a specific criterion has been complied with at a test site. This standard includes only those measurement techniques that relate to the criteria or special conditions contained in NACE Standard RP0285. The measurement techniques described in this standard require that measurements be made in the field. Because these measurements are obtained under widely varying circumstances of field conditions and tank design, this standard is not as prescriptive as those NACE standard test methods that use laboratory measurements. Instead, this standard gives the user latitude to make testing decisions in the field based on the technical facts available.
